Question:
What can SVP learn from other groups that also pool funds for grant giving?
Answer:
There are several other pooled giving efforts around the country. In the Seattle region, Washington Women's Foundation, the Threshold Foundation, and A Territory Resource are all good resources for SVP. There are others throughout the nation, and there are many important lessons from these groups: Clear grant giving criteria is essential. Good grant people who can set aside their personal interests to see opportunities that serve the group's goals lead committees. Site visits to prospective investees are invaluable in learning about specific efforts and increase philanthropy skills. SVP will continue to draw on the experience of others.
